Position OverviewThe CDL Equipment Operator – Air Mover / Vacuum Excavation is a hands-on field role responsible for safely operating vacuum trucks and air mover systems to perform precision vacuum soil excavation on environmental remediation, utility exposure, and demolition-related projects.
This position supports projects across Atlanta and the southeastern U.S. Travel is required for select projects, with per diem and lodging provided for out-of-town assignments.
Key ResponsibilitiesOperate air mover vacuum trucks and associated excavation equipment to perform vacuum soil excavation (dry excavation) safely and efficiently.
Perform controlled excavation around utilities, foundations, and sensitive infrastructure.
